Private Phone Records Sold Online, Privacy Group Complains

The Electronic Privacy Information Center wants telecommunications carriers to do more to prevent customer information from being sold online. The Electronic Privacy Information Center (Epic), an online privacy advocacy group, on Tuesday petitioned the Federal Communications Commission to require that telecommunications carriers establish better policies and procedures to prevent customer billing records from being sold [...]
